Opciones de instalación "predeterminadas" de CentOS 6

47

¿Alguien puede decirme la diferencia entre una instalación de escritorio, una instalación de servidor básico y una instalación mínima? Durante la instalación, no da una descripción y tampoco puedo encontrar documentación al respecto.

Esto es para una instalación de CentOS 6.

Mechaflash
fuente

Respuestas:

66

Como ya ha notado, la descripción de Red Hat es vaga sobre lo que cada suite realmente incluye. A continuación se muestra una lista de los grupos de paquetes que instalará cada suite.

Puede obtener más información sobre qué grupo de paquetes ejecutando yum groupinfo foo-bar. Los nombres que se enumeran a continuación difieren de lo que yum grouplistfigurará en la lista, pero la información de grupo cobase, consola-internet, núcleo, depuración, directorio-cliente, monitoreo de hardware, plataforma java, sistemas grandes, red-archivo-cliente-sistema, rendimiento, perl- tiempo de ejecución, server-platformmmand todavía funciona en ellos.

Obtuve esto montando http://mirror.centos.org/centos-6/6/os/x86_64/images/install.img y mirando /usr/lib/anaconda/installclasses/rhel.py dentro de la imagen.

Escritorio : base, escritorio básico, núcleo, depuración, depuración de escritorio, plataforma de escritorio, cliente de directorio, fuentes, escritorio general, herramientas gráficas de administración, métodos de entrada, aplicaciones de internet, navegador de internet, java- plataforma, legacy-x, cliente de sistema de archivos de red, suite de oficina, cliente de impresión, clientes de escritorio remoto, plataforma de servidor, x11

Escritorio mínimo : base, escritorio básico, núcleo, depuración, depuración de escritorio, plataforma de escritorio, cliente de directorio, fuentes, métodos de entrada, navegador de internet, plataforma java, legado-x, cliente de sistema de archivos de red , cliente de impresión, clientes de escritorio remoto, plataforma de servidor, x11

Mínimo : núcleo

Servidor básico : base, consola-internet, núcleo, depuración, directorio-cliente, monitoreo de hardware, plataforma java, sistemas grandes, red-archivo-cliente-sistema, rendimiento, tiempo de ejecución perl, plataforma-servidor

Servidor de base de datos : base, consola-internet, núcleo, depuración, directorio-cliente, monitoreo de hardware, plataforma java, sistemas grandes, red-archivo-cliente-sistema, rendimiento, tiempo de ejecución perl, plataforma-servidor, cliente-mysql , mysql, postgresql-client, postgresql, system-admin-tools

Servidor web : base, consola-internet, núcleo, depuración, directorio-cliente, java-plataforma, mysql-cliente, red-archivo-sistema-cliente, rendimiento, perl-runtime, php, postgresql-cliente, servidor-plataforma, turbogears , servidor web, servlet web

Host virtual : base, consola-internet, núcleo, depuración, directorio-cliente, monitoreo de hardware, plataforma java, sistemas grandes, red-archivo-cliente-sistema, rendimiento, tiempo de ejecución perl, plataforma de servidor, virtualización, virtualización -cliente, plataforma de virtualización

Estación de trabajo de desarrollo de software: desarrollo adicional, base, escritorio básico, núcleo, depuración, depuración de escritorio, plataforma de escritorio, desarrollo de plataforma de escritorio, desarrollo, directorio-cliente, eclipse, emacs, fuentes, escritorio general, gráfico herramientas administrativas, gráficos, métodos de entrada, navegador de internet, plataforma java, legado-x, cliente de sistema de archivos de red, rendimiento, tiempo de ejecución perl, cliente de impresión, clientes de escritorio remoto, plataforma de servidor, desarrollo de plataforma de servidor, escritura técnica, tex, virtualización, cliente de virtualización, plataforma de virtualización, x11

Mark McKinstry
fuente
El servidor básico y el servidor de base de datos son exactamente iguales en su lista. ¿Puede ser eso correcto?
Sandra Schlichting
@SandraSchlichting Debo haber copiado y pegado mal. Actualicé la lista para corregir la sección Servidor de base de datos.
Mark McKinstry
5

La Guía de instalación de Red Hat Enterprise Linux 6 sección 9.17. Package Group Selection proporciona información, pero no mucha:

Por defecto, el proceso de instalación de Red Hat Enterprise Linux carga una selección de software que es adecuado para un sistema implementado como servidor básico. Tenga en cuenta que esta instalación no incluye un entorno gráfico. Para incluir una selección de software adecuado para otros roles, haga clic en el botón de radio que corresponde a una de las siguientes opciones:

Servidor Básico

Esta opción proporciona una instalación básica de Red Hat Enterprise Linux para usar en un servidor.

Escritorio

Esta opción proporciona el conjunto de productividad OpenOffice.org, herramientas gráficas como> el GIMP y aplicaciones multimedia.

Mínimo

Esta opción proporciona solo los paquetes esenciales para ejecutar Red Hat Enterprise Linux. Una instalación mínima proporciona la base para un servidor de un solo propósito o un dispositivo de escritorio y maximiza el rendimiento y la seguridad en dicha instalación.

Stefan Lasiewski
fuente
+1 sí, eso es todo lo que encontré también. Esperaba que hubiera algún sitio que tuviera información del paquete para las instalaciones. Supongo que seguiremos con el que 'creemos' que nos dará los paquetes que necesitamos y luego instalaremos cualquier otra cosa = (dejaré esto sin respuesta por un día para ver si alguien tiene un enlace informativo para las diferentes instalaciones.
Mechaflash
Hago esta misma maldita pregunta (o una similar) cada dos años . Algún día puedo encontrar una buena respuesta.
Stefan Lasiewski
jajaja Tal vez cuando lo chmod a-laziness dev-teamdocumenten mejor = P
Mechaflash